I think you are trying to do something like this:


=(IF(B8="Small",VLOOKUP(A14,'Property List'!
L3:M15,2,0),IF(B8="Medium",VLOOKUP(A14,'Property List'!
L19:M31,2,0),IF(B8="Large",VLOOKUP(A14,'Property List'!
L35:M47,2,0),"")))

I need a formula that will return certain valued based on the fact if they
are Small, Medium or Large. For example, if someone says the product is small
if should go to a table I have and look up the values for the column and
return them...if they say Large then it should take another set of numbers
I was thinking the following formula but Excel says I have too many
arguments for this formula....can you assist?


=(IF(B8="Small","",VLOOKUP(A14,'Property
List'!L3:M15,2,0),if(B8="Medium","",vlookup(A14,'P roperty
List'!L19:M31,2,0),if(B8="Large","",vlookup('Team Bonus'!A14,'Property
List'!L35:M47,2,0))))
